Как восстановить пароль от MySQL Ubuntu: легкий способ и инструкция для восстановления

Для восстановления пароля от MySQL на Ubuntu, вам потребуется выполнить следующие шаги:

  1. Откройте терминал или командную строку.
  2. Войдите в систему в качестве пользователя root командой:
  3. sudo su
  4. Остановите службу MySQL с помощью команды:
  5. service mysql stop
  6. Запустите службу MySQL в режиме без проверки прав доступа:
  7. mysqld_safe --skip-grant-tables &
  8. Войдите в интерактивный режим MySQL:
  9. mysql -u root
  10. Используйте следующую команду для изменения пароля:
  11. UPDATE mysql.user SET authentication_string=PASSWORD('новый_пароль') WHERE User='root';
  12. Обновите привилегии и выйдите из MySQL:
  13. FLUSH PRIVILEGES;
    exit;
  14. Остановите службу MySQL:
  15. service mysql stop
  16. Запустите службу MySQL:
  17. service mysql start

Теперь вы должны иметь возможность войти в MySQL с использованием нового пароля.

Детальный ответ

Как восстановить пароль от MySQL на Ubuntu?

Забытый пароль от MySQL базы данных может стать большой проблемой, но не паникуйте! В этой статье я покажу вам, как восстановить пароль от MySQL на вашем сервере Ubuntu.

Есть несколько шагов, которые мы должны выполнить, чтобы восстановить пароль:

Шаг 1: Остановите службу MySQL

Перед восстановлением пароля от MySQL базы данных, вам нужно остановить службу MySQL. Вы можете сделать это с помощью следующей команды:

sudo service mysql stop

Шаг 2: Запустите MySQL с параметрами безопасности

Теперь мы запустим MySQL с дополнительными параметрами безопасности. Для этого воспользуйтесь следующей командой:

sudo mysqld_safe --skip-grant-tables &

Эта команда запустит MySQL с параметром --skip-grant-tables, который позволяет использовать базу данных без проверки учетных данных и правил доступа. Будьте осторожны, эта настройка делает базу данных уязвимой, поэтому не используйте ее на продакшен-сервере.

Шаг 3: Подключитесь к MySQL

Теперь мы можем подключиться к MySQL базе данных без пароля. Запустите следующую команду:

mysql -u root

Вы успешно подключились к MySQL базе данных! Теперь давайте изменим пароль.

Шаг 4: Измените пароль

После успешного подключения к MySQL базе данных вы можете изменить пароль с помощью следующего SQL-запроса:

UPDATE mysql.user SET authentication_string=PASSWORD('новый_пароль') WHERE User='root';

Замените новый_пароль на ваш желаемый пароль. После этого выполните следующий SQL-запрос для применения изменений:

FLUSH PRIVILEGES;

Шаг 5: Перезапустите MySQL

Теперь мы можем перезапустить службу MySQL, чтобы применить изменения. Воспользуйтесь следующей командой:

sudo service mysql restart

Поздравляю! Вы только что успешно восстановили пароль от MySQL базы данных на сервере Ubuntu.

В заключение

В данной статье я показал вам, как восстановить пароль от MySQL на Ubuntu. Следуйте этим шагам и вы сможете снова получить доступ к вашей базе данных. Помните, что безопасность очень важна, поэтому будьте осторожны при использовании команды --skip-grant-tables и обязательно измените пароль после восстановления доступа.

Видео по теме

Сброс пароля сервера mysql в Linux

Сброс пароля ROOT в MySQL

Как сбросить пароль для входа в Linux

Похожие статьи:

Как сделать дубликат таблицы MySQL: простое руководство для начинающих

Как восстановить пароль от MySQL Ubuntu: легкий способ и инструкция для восстановления

Как связать MySQL и C: руководство для разработчиков и специалистов

🔑 Как восстановить пароль от MySQL: подробная инструкция для начинающих пошагово